In order to establish control values for the adhesives formulated using tannins, the initial work was done with phenol-resorcinol-formaldehyde (PRF) or resorcinol-formaldehyde (RF) resins on both surfaces, but modified for the honeymoon principle. The PRF resin chosen for this work was Borden s resin LT-75 with Borden s hardener FM-260. The RF resin used for a comparison was Chembond s RF-900. These resins have been used for wood gluing in the United States for more than two decades, especially for the manufacture of structural laminated timbers. [Pg.205]

One particular structural application of adhesives is in the manufacture of glued laminated timber or glulam members. This is normally manufactured by glueing together at least four planks of timber with their grain essentially parallel. The laminations are usually machined from 38 or 50 mm thick timber although thinner sections may be necessary in the production of curved members. End... [Pg.262]

Useful mono-material structural elements may be formed by bonding together a number of individual pieces of the same material. Glued laminated timber (glulam) members as described in Chapter 7 represent a development in which structural elements of large cross-section may be created. Adhesive bonding, as opposed to mechanical fastening, leads to reduced stress concentrations as well as the elimination of joint slip. The adhesives are used in the construction industry that includes residential and commercial buildings, roads, bridges, and other elements of the infrastructure. They are utilized for manufacturing a number of structural products, such as softwood plywood, laminated timbers, laminated paper-based panels, etc. More recently, adhesives have been used to replace mechanical fastenings in the assembly operation of building construction. These are called construction adhesives. The compounds must be capable of producing adequate bonds in poorly fitting joints with thick and variable thickness bondlines.t " ... [Pg.541]

The joining of wood by adhesives is widely used in many fields of application. This comprises structural joints, glued-laminated timber, and coatings. In industrial processes, wood is structurally connected by formaldehyde-containing melamine or phenol resorcin resins which cure by polycondensation. Due to the very thin adhesive layers and the minimized formaldehyde content, the expected incorporation into the surrounding air is considerably less than the specified thresholds. In manually operated applications, dispersions of acrylates and polyvinyl acetate as well as urethanes are usually used to bond wood (Richter and Steiger 2005). [Pg.1281]

Developments in glued laminated structures and panel products such as plywood and chipboard raises the question of the durability of adhesives as well as wood. Urea-formaldehyde adhesives are most commonly used for indoor components. For exterior use, resorcinol adhesives are used for assembly work, whilst phenolic, tannin and melamine/urea adhesives are used for manufactured wood products. Urea and casein adhesives can give good outdoor service if protected with well-maintained surface finishes. Assembly failures of adhesives caused by exudates from some timber species can be avoided by freshly sanding the surfaces before glue application. [Pg.960]
